Text
(a)The petition shall be served on the defendant in accordance with the provisions of K.S.A. 61-3001 through 61-3006, and amendments thereto.
(b)All pleadings other than the petition, motions which cannot be heard ex parte, notices, and orders which are required by their terms to be served, shall be served upon the party's attorney of record, if the party is represented by an attorney, or upon the party if not represented by an attorney, in the following manner:
(1)By delivering a copy;
(2)by mailing a copy by first-class mail, certified mail or registered mail to the last known address; or
